John Baxter Carder
MilitaryAssigned to 364FS, 357FG, 8AF USAAF. Credited with 7 kills and 1 damaged. Shot down GAF P-47, but not credited with kill. Failed to Return (FTR) ramrod to Bruk, Czech in P-51 42-106777. Last seen in combat covering wingman as he dealt with Me109 10 miles NW Schweinfurt crashed near Bischoffen, Province Hessen Nassau, district Dillkreis. 12-May-44 Prisoner of War (POW). MACR 4701. He made two escape attempts, and was successful on his second effort, and returned to his unit.
Awards: DFC (OLC), POW, WWII Victory, EAME.
Post war: Killed in civil aircraft 1-Oct-61.
